News summary

On Sept. 28, 2025, a house fire during a birthday gathering in Lebanon, Pennsylvania, killed five people, including 4-year-old Veyda Pereyra. Investigators say the blaze was accidental and started from an electrical outlet in a first-floor living room. Veyda’s mother, EMT Azelyn Arenas of First Aid & Safety Patrol, was among the first responders and arrived to find her daughter among the victims, a scene colleagues described as “our worst nightmare.” Other victims included 73-year-old caretaker Josefina Estevez and three others reported as ages 1, 17 and 23; two additional people were injured. The community has rallied with a GoFundMe that quickly surpassed its initial goal, and county authorities have activated crisis-intervention and counseling resources for first responders and affected families.
